Indonesian national  law derived  from western law, customary law and Islamic law. Given the efforts to  establish the  institution  of Islamic  law  in Indonesia experienced many  challenges and  Religious  Courts institutions is still lacking in authority. Prof. Dr. H. Busthanul Arifin, SH continue to think seriously to make Islamic law as an integral part of the national  legal system. In the end, he can implement his ideals. Based on the above background of this study  revealed three  issues,  namely  First, Is Arifin Busthanul  contribute ideas  about  the institutionalization of Islamic  law in the  national  legal system.  Second, Is Arifin Busthanul  thinking  about  the authority of the Religious Courts in the national  legal system.  Third, How implications Arifin Busthanul  thinking on the institutionalization of Islamic law and  the authority  of the Religious Courts in the national  legal system to the development of Islamic law in Indonesia. The purpose of this study was  that Muslims know  the figures that played  a major  role behind the  enactment of Law Number.  7 Year 1989 regarding the  enactment of the Religious and Islamic Law Compilation  (KHI).Theoretical  studies in this research is the theory of the formation of the institutionalization of Islamic law, the theory of the relation  between religion and state  law and political theory. This research is a research study of character with the historical approach, the approach of the Act, the conceptual approach, and the comparative approach and data analysis techniques using inductive method. The results  of this study explains  that Islamic  law referred to and  determined by the legislation  can  apply directly without  going through  traditional  law,  the  Republic  of Indonesia (the  Government) can  set  something of a problem in accordance with Islamic  law, all the  settings  that apply only to the  followers  of Islam and  results Busthanul  Arifin contribute ideas  about  the  institutionalization of Islamic  law  are:  1. draft  Law on  Religious Courts, 2. draft Compilation  of Islamic  Law. Privileges Religious Courts under  Act Number.  3 2006 was  in the field of civil law include:  marriage, inheritance wills, grants,  endowments, alms,  charity, donation and  sharia economy. Implications of thought  Busthanul  Arifin against  the  Islamic  law in Indonesia is the  emergence  of legislation  that comes from Islamic  law, for example the  Law on Hajj, Zakat, Infak, Endowments, Economic Regulation  Based Regional Shari’ah and religion.
